Do I need prior experience to go water skiing or wakeboarding in Key West?

No experience is required. This Key West wakeboarding and water skiing experience is designed for all skill levels, including first-timers. Your instructor will provide full on-water coaching, helping you get up on the water, maintain balance, and build confidence at your own pace in the calm Florida Keys waters.

What equipment is provided for the Key West wakeboarding experience?

All necessary equipment is included, such as wakeboards or water skis, life jackets, and safety gear. The boat is equipped with professional-grade tow systems and is operated by experienced captains who know the best areas around Key West for smooth water conditions.

Where does the water skiing and wakeboarding take place in Key West?

Sessions take place in the protected nearshore waters around Key West, offering warm, clear conditions and relatively calm seas. Your captain will choose the best location based on daily conditions to ensure the smoothest and most enjoyable ride possible.

Is this activity suitable for children and beginners?

Yes, this experience is suitable for beginners and younger participants who meet basic strength and comfort requirements in the water. Instructors provide step-by-step guidance, making it a great introduction to both wakeboarding and water skiing in a safe, supportive environment.

What conditions can I expect when wakeboarding in Key West?

Key West typically offers warm tropical weather and generally calm morning waters, which are ideal for wakeboarding and water skiing. Conditions can vary slightly depending on wind and tides, but captains aim to select the smoothest areas for the best possible ride experience.
